Matching part of a string of text

Hi

I have product code numbers and product descriptions in a table in Qlikview.  In an excel spreadsheet somebody inputs the product code from a debit note issued by a customer.  The reliability of the product number on the debit note is not good and there is often either the first number, last number or both missing.  I want to look up the number input onto the spreadsheet with the product code numbers in qlikview to return the product description.  I need the numbers to match as in the table below

ProdNoDebitNoteProd
0183091001830910
013773010137730
016177981617798
01546764154676

Is the wildmatch function the right solution?

Hi

You will get false matches if your strings are in a sequence

DebitNoteProd ='*0137730*'

ProdNo

'01377301'

'01377302'

'01377303'
